潑請弝け University Welcomes its Largest Class Ever, 2018

More than 350 staff and student volunteers, including athletes, RAs, and student government leaders greeted and helped move in more than 1,000 first-year students, 50 transfer students and 150 international students on Sunday, August 31.

I was completely impressed with how smooth Move-In Day went. All of us came together - facilities, catering, athletics, student leaders, FUSA, Public Safety, staff, administrators, and faculty - to ensure a welcoming and smooth process. Its one of the things that makes 潑請弝け special, commented Kamala Kiem, assistant dean of students & director, Student Programs & Leadership Development.

Since move-in, the members of the Class of 2018 have been attending important sessions to prepare them academically and socially for the year to come. Some highlights include:

- Residence Hall Community Meetings

- Late-night entertainment, including comedian Joe DeVito and 潑請弝け University Your Mom Does Improv, and The Neighbors movie showing

- Once a Stag, Always a Stag, a welcoming session which encourages school pride and sprit

- Step Up Stags 2, a presentation that continued a dialogue started at Orientation about bystander intervention and student accountability

- A Fun Run Routes around campus led by New Student Leaders

- A Scavenger Hunt, in partnership with our downtown bookstore
